Transaction

e562ca54e71d04ec4591096ff815fa8cddc12d961cb4e94e4e45b4107fa3495a
291,355 confirmations
Timestamp
1599664315
Block647,487
Fee22,148 sats
Fee rate98.9 sats/vB
view on mempool.space

Inputs & Outputs